40,000 tickets sold in six hours for Turkish GP
Turkish Grand Prix organisers, who are aiming for a crowd of 100,000 on November 15, were nearly halfway to that target after just six hours of tickets being on sale. Istanbul Park is back on the F1 calendar for the first time since 2011, added as an extra round to a finalised 17-race schedule which has had to be drastically rejigged due to the global health pandemic. At a recent press conference, Vural Ak, chairman of race promoters Intercity, revealed he was aiming for a six-figure attendance at the grand prix which, for the time being, will be a one-off return to Turkey.
